An Algorithm of Anti-Aliasing and Real-Time Shadow Rendering Based On Shadow Maps

作者:Jun, Li; Jin Hanjun*; Yang, Jincai; Jin, Yin; Liu, Xiaojiao
来源:Information-An International Interdisciplinary Journal, 2012, 15(9): 3727-3733.

摘要

Aliasing problem for shadow maps, this paper presents a real-time and anti-aliasing shadow rendering algorithm based on shadow maps. This algorithm uses shadow maps based on image space render non-shadow boundary regions and then shadow volumes based on object space to deal with shadow boundary regions. In the implementation process, this paper also proposed to use NURBS curve drawing method and combine shadow boundary points to determine contour edge of the object in order to achieve clear shadow boundary. It not only solves the problem that shadow maps cause aliasing, but also quickly renders shadow in the scene. Programming experiments proved algorithm makes shadow satisfy the requirements of realism and real-time in the three-dimensional virtual scene.

全文